A. Online robo-advisor is a low cost of curated investing, it typically asks you a few questions to determine your risk tolerance level, then recommend the appropriate portfolio allocations for you to invest.
However, there are two ways to investing - risk-based and goal-based, we will illustrate with a travel analog below -
Let's say you are in NY, you want to go to LA. If you use the risk-based approach, you might assess your risk tolerance level - can you take air travel? If you feel that's too risky, you may take train.
With the goal-based approach, you will ask yourself - when do I need to reach LA? If by tomorrow morning, then you have to take air travel, which is the most likely way to achieve your goal, even though the risk might be high for you.
Which investment approach is more appropriate for you? Only you can make the final decision.
